Personal data Henricus Douffen 


Household of Henricus Douffen

He is married to Maria Leumens.

They were married in church on February 26, 1642 at Merkelbeek, (Beekdaelen), Limburg, Nederland.Source 1


Child(ren):

  1. Petrus Douven  1642-????
  2. Joannes Douffen  1652-1722
